The Paid Search Account Manager will lead a portfolio of ecommerce clients, owning channel performance, steering strategy and guiding junior team members to deliver best-in-class work.
The Paid Search Account Manager will:
- Oversee Paid Search performance across up to four ecommerce accounts
- Produce compelling proposals that unlock incremental performance
- Lead the delivery and quality of all Paid Search execution
- Mentor junior Executives, raising capability and consistency
Deep understanding of ecommerce performance levers and optimisation tactics.
Confidence managing multiple accounts and prioritising effectively.
